David Reekie Obituary: Ice Hockey Goaltender Passes Away in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an
Saskatoon, SK – The Canadian hockey community is mourning the tragic loss of David Reekie, a talented goaltender for the Leader Flyers in the Western Manitoba Hockey League (WMHL), who has sadly passed away. Reekie, known for his unwavering dedication, skill, and passion for the game, was 38 years old at the time of his passing.
Born on July 16, 1987, in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an, David Reekie grew up with a deep love for hockey—a sport that would shape much of his life and identity. Standing at 181 cm (5’11”) and weighing 84 kg (185 lbs), Reekie was recognized for his quick reflexes, resilience under pressure, and strong leadership both on and off the ice.
A Beloved Member of the Hockey Community
Reekie’s career spanned multiple years and leagues, where he earned the respect of teammates, coaches, and fans alike. As the #33 goaltender for the Leader Flyers during the 2024/2025 WMHL season, he continued to showcase his talent, sportsmanship, and dedication to the game. His contributions extended beyond the rink, where he was admired for his humility, mentorship, and commitment to supporting younger players.
